Hi guys, I've found an Omega for sale, for cheap but has an issue. Owner says it wants to overheat and fans don't kick in until temp warning light doesn't appears. Radiator was replaced, looses ver small amount of coolant every few months and suprisingly doesn't leak oil (plug wells aren't full yet  ::) )
Problem is he lives 150 km away and in order to drive home I can't drive with overheating car.
The reason I noticed this Omega at all is how healthy body it has. Only a small almost invisible spot of rust behind rear right wheell.
It would be a shame for it to be scrapped.
What do you think what could be the reason for overheating?
Simple as a thermoswitch or something more sinister?

This is an issue for at least a year now, but there were many other things to do. Vibrations occure when accelerating on motorway in 3rd mostly and when breaking from motorway speed.
Discs and pads are new - all corners, new drop links. I believe front suspension arms are still original, could there be so much play in those when under stress? There's no obvious play in wheells.
Before I take those off and ruin the alignment - front ones or rear ones?
